List by list

  • England and Wales · Boys16 shared years, 20022024

    Hunter held the stronger position in 15 of those years, Wyn in 1.

    Highest recorded here: Hunter #44 in 2018, Wyn #1675 in 2024.

    The order changed in 2007: Hunter moved ahead. In 2006 they stood at #2254 and #1799; by 2007 that had become #926 and #4333.

    Most recent shared year, 2024: Hunter #78, Wyn #1675.

How each name got here

Hunter

Popularity journey

  1. First recorded1996

    First recorded at #2357 among boys in England and Wales in 1996 — the earliest year that source publishes this name, not necessarily the earliest it was used.

    England and Wales · Boys

  2. Highest recorded1999–2023

    Highest recorded position: #5 among boys in New Zealand, in 2017 (recorded 1999–2023).

    New Zealand · Boys

  3. Most recent2025

    Most recently recorded at #60 among boys in New South Wales, Australia, in 2025.

    New South Wales, Australia · Boys
